Reason #1: It’s a Great Partner for Multitasking

Many of us live life on the go or enjoy multitasking, which means we want to consume digestible and on-the-go friendly content—this is exactly what podcasts are. Podcasts keep you entertained while you’re driving to work, cooking some dishes, or even cleaning your home.

The thing is, podcasts aren’t just background noise—they can be entertaining and educational, allowing you to absorb helpful content while doing mundane tasks and chores. Listening to something keeps your mind from going numb out of boredom, which serves as a subtle booster that aids in finishing tasks much faster and easier.

Reason #2: Encourages Limited Screen Time

Because you’ll be listening, you won’t be needing to glue your face on the screen. You get to cut down your screen time and let your eyes rest since you’re limiting visual strain. Not to mention, podcasts encourage imagination, allowing you to stimulate your mind and give your brain a bit of mental exercise.

Reason #3: It’s an Essential Tool for Success

As mentioned earlier, podcasts are a great tool to help you absorb digestible educational content. Podcasts are actually an effective tool for success since you’ll get to stimulate your brain and learn new concepts and ideas that could help improve your talents and skills.

Another reason podcasts can help shape your success is because you’ll be listening to episodes and interviews straight from the experts. You can think of it this way—it’s like a class or seminar on the go, and to top it all off, you’re learning from the best!
